TCPView:Win进程端口占用监控工具
需积分: 4 16 浏览量
更新于2024-10-09
收藏 850KB ZIP 举报
资源摘要信息:"TCPView是一款在Windows操作系统上使用的进程查看器,专门用于监控和显示当前系统中所有TCP/IP和UDP网络连接的状态。它能够显示每个进程所使用的网络端口,帮助用户快速了解哪些程序在使用网络资源。TCPView不仅可以提供每个端口的占用信息,还能实时更新端口状态,这对于网络管理员来说是一个非常有用的工具,因为它能够帮助他们诊断和解决问题,比如端口冲突或网络使用不当等问题。此外,TCPView也是一款轻量级的软件,不需要复杂的配置,打开即用,非常适合不熟悉命令行工具的普通用户。"
知识点详细说明:
1. TCPView的功能和用途:
- TCPView是一个实时的进程监控工具,它能够列出当前所有的TCP连接和UDP监听端口。
- 它显示了关于每个TCP连接或UDP端口的详细信息,包括本地地址、本地端口、远程地址、远程端口、状态以及进程标识符(PID)。
- TCPView常用于网络调试,帮助用户识别哪个进程正在监听特定的端口,这对于确定网络问题和安全审计非常有帮助。
2. TCPView的工作原理:
- TCPView利用Windows操作系统提供的底层网络API来监控当前的网络活动。
- 它解析系统内部的TCP/IP和UDP协议栈信息,并以易于理解的方式呈现给用户。
- 该工具能够自动刷新数据,以便用户能够看到最新的连接状态和活动进程。
3. 使用场景和优势:
- 网络管理员可以使用TCPView来检测和解决网络问题,比如发现哪些程序在进行不正常的网络通信。
- 开发人员在开发网络应用程序时,可以利用TCPView来测试和调试程序,确保其正确使用网络资源。
- 在安全方面,TCPView能够辅助发现潜在的安全威胁,例如检测到未授权的应用程序试图访问网络。
4. 如何安装和运行TCPView:
- TCPView作为一个独立的可执行程序,通常只需要下载、解压并运行即可。
- 它不需要安装过程,也不依赖于操作系统的组件,是一款绿色软件。
- 用户通过直接双击TCPView.exe文件即可启动程序,无需担心安装路径和注册表的修改。
5. TCPView与传统命令行工具的对比:
- 传统的Windows命令行工具,如netstat和tasklist,也可以提供类似的网络连接和进程信息。
- 然而,TCPView提供了一个图形用户界面(GUI),这使得信息的查看和解读更加直观。
- 相较于命令行工具,TCPView的实时更新功能和用户友好的界面,使得它在处理大量数据时更为便捷。
6. TCPView的限制和注意事项:
- TCPView可能无法显示所有网络连接信息,尤其是对于某些系统进程或服务,它可能显示“未知”或不完整的连接信息。
- TCPView更新的是当前的网络状态快照,因此需要用户根据实际情况不断刷新界面,以获取最新的数据。
- 在使用TCPView进行网络诊断时,应考虑到网络环境的动态变化,避免单次快照的误导。
总结,TCPView作为一款专业的端口和进程监控工具,在Windows平台上为用户提供了方便、快捷的网络状态观察和分析手段。其易于操作的界面和无需安装的便捷特性,使得它成为网络管理员和开发人员不可或缺的辅助工具之一。对于需要快速诊断网络问题或监控系统网络活动的用户而言,TCPView是一个有效的选择。
164 浏览量
200 浏览量
122 浏览量
2009-03-18 上传
2011-12-10 上传
2018-02-05 上传
232 浏览量
467 浏览量
2689 浏览量
runnerrunning
- 粉丝: 5
- 资源: 34
最新资源
- AS3类关系图(pdf格式)
- Head First C#中文版 崔鹏飞翻译
- 计算机组成原理(第三版)习题答案
- Programming C# English
- 计算机操作系统(汤子瀛)习题答案
- 使用JCreator开发JSP或servlet.pdf
- 南开100题帮你过国家三级
- 单片机课程设计-交通灯控制系统
- Labview7.0中文教程
- 网页常用的 js脚本总汇
- 系统分析师考试大纲系统分析师考试大纲系统分析师考试大纲系统分析师考试大纲
- 嵌入式linux系统开发技术详解 — 基于ARM.pdf
- matlab2008a安装过程出现问题的解决方案
- CPU占用率高 的九种可能
- [三思笔记]一步一步学DataGuard.pdf
- VBScript脚本语言—入门到提高